#3b0168 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3b0168 is composed of 23.1% red, 0.4%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.3% cyan, 99%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 273.8 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 20.6%. #3b0168 color hex could be obtained by blending #7602d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#3b0168 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#3b0168 has RGB values of R:59, G:1,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.43,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 3866984.
